Definition of Laboratory Testing and Its Processes

Laboratory testing plays a crucial role in diagnosing diseases and monitoring health. This type of testing typically occurs in controlled environments. Here, trained professionals use sophisticated equipment to analyze samples. According to the World Health Organization, more than 70% of clinical decisions rely on laboratory test results. These results can significantly influence treatment plans and patient outcomes.

The process involves several steps. Initially, specimens are collected from the patient. Next, they undergo preparation and analysis. Quality control measures ensure accuracy and reliability. Even with strict protocols, issues can arise. Sample contamination or improper handling can lead to erroneous results. A study by the National Institutes of Health indicated that up to 5% of laboratory results contain critical errors. Such mistakes highlight the challenges within laboratory testing, emphasizing the need for continuous improvement.

Moreover, laboratory tests typically take longer than point-of-care testing methods. This delay can be critical in emergency situations. While laboratory testing provides comprehensive data, point-of-care tests offer instant results. Each method has its own merits. Understanding these differences is essential for effective patient care.

Definition of Point of Care Testing and Its Application

Point of Care Testing (POCT)

refers to medical diagnostic testing conducted at or near the site of patient care. This approach has grown in popularity due to its convenience and immediate results. According to industry reports, nearly 70% of clinical decision-making is influenced by laboratory test results. POCT allows for rapid diagnosis and timely treatment, especially in critical care settings.

The applications of POCT are diverse. For instance, rapid tests for infectious diseases can lead to quicker isolation protocols. A study by the World Health Organization indicated that timely detection of conditions like HIV and malaria could reduce mortality rates by over 30%. Moreover, POCT devices often require minimal training, making them accessible for use in various settings, including rural health clinics and emergency rooms.

However, while POCT offers many advantages, it also presents challenges. Sensitivity and specificity may differ from conventional laboratory testing. Ensuring quality control is essential but can be more complex outside traditional labs. Additionally, the integration of POCT data with electronic health records remains an area that needs improvement. Despite these challenges, the continued advancement of POCT technologies shows promise for enhancing patient outcomes in real-time scenarios.

Key Differences in Testing Environments and Procedures

Laboratory testing and point of care (POC) testing differ significantly in both environments and procedures. Laboratory testing is typically conducted in controlled settings. Samples are processed using sophisticated equipment. These tests often require specialized personnel to maintain accuracy. According to a report by the National Institutes of Health, laboratory tests can take several hours to days to yield results. The precision of these tests is high, making them essential for complex diagnoses.

In contrast, point of care testing occurs where patients receive care. This can be in a clinic, emergency room, or even at home. POC tests are designed for speed and convenience. They provide rapid results, often within minutes. A study published in the Journal of Clinical Microbiology indicates that POC testing can significantly reduce turnaround time by up to 80%. However, the accuracy can sometimes be less than that of laboratory tests, leading to potential misdiagnoses.

Both testing types have their strengths and weaknesses. While laboratory tests excel in accuracy, POC tests are valuable for quick decision-making. Understanding these differences is crucial for healthcare providers. The effectiveness of patient care hinges on choosing the appropriate testing method based on specific needs.

Advantages and Disadvantages of Each Testing Method

Laboratory testing and point of care (POC) testing serve different roles in healthcare. Laboratory tests are often more comprehensive and accurate. These tests rely on sophisticated technology and specialized personnel. They can provide detailed analyses of blood, urine, and other samples. However, the turnaround time is longer, and samples need to be transported to a lab. This can delay treatment decisions.

In contrast, POC testing delivers results quickly, often within minutes. These tests can be performed at the patient's bedside or in a doctor's office. They are user-friendly and can be operated by non-laboratory staff. This immediacy allows for timely interventions. However, POC tests may sacrifice some accuracy and depth. They are generally more limited in scope, often providing only essential information. Healthcare providers must weigh the benefits of speed against potential risks associated with less reliable results.

Each testing method has its place in patient care. Choosing the right one depends on the clinical context and patient needs. Balancing speed and accuracy is crucial. Often, healthcare providers may rely on both types of testing to ensure comprehensive care.

Impact on Patient Care and Clinical Decision-Making

Laboratory testing and point-of-care testing (POCT) differ significantly in their impact on patient care and clinical decision-making. Traditional laboratory tests often take longer to deliver results. According to a report by the National Institutes of Health, these delays can range from several hours to days. In contrast, POCT can provide immediate results, allowing for timely diagnosis and treatment. This rapid turnaround enhances patient satisfaction and helps healthcare providers make quicker decisions.

The immediate feedback from POCT has transformed clinical practices. For instance, a study published in the Journal of Clinical Pathology found that POCT reduced unnecessary hospital admissions by 30%. Clinicians are empowered to diagnose conditions like strep throat, diabetes, or cardiac markers on the spot. However, some challenges persist. The reliability of certain POCT devices can vary, leading to false positives or negatives. This requires healthcare providers to balance speed and accuracy in patient management.

Moreover, implementing POCT can strain resources. Training staff to use these devices effectively is essential. Misinterpretation of results can occur without adequate training. Therefore, while POCT offers significant advantages, it necessitates continuous evaluation and adaptation in clinical settings. Keeping these factors in mind will help maximize its benefits for patient care.
